
Hema Weerakoon is a grade one medical officer, working in Teaching Hospital Anuradhapura, Sri Lanka as an in charge medical officer in outpatient department. She was educated in university of Peradeniya, Sri Lanka. She holds medical degree of bachelor of medicine and bachelor of surgery. She took up her first permanent position as senior house officer in surgical department of Teaching hospital, Anuradhapura, Sri Lanka in 1998. She has worked in curative as well as preventive health sector for more than 25 years. In curative health sector she has worked in Teaching hospital, Anuradhapura as medical officer /dermatology and medical officer /sexual health centre. She also worked in peripheral divisional hospitals in Anuradhapura. In preventive health sector she has worked as medical officer planning and medical officer public health in provincial health department North Central Province Sri Lanka. Other than duty at government health sector she is doing private medical practice at Anuradhapura Sri Lanka.
She has contributed to 25 research publications mainly tropical disease; leishmaniasis, leprosy and public health. She has done more than 30 presentations in regional, national and international scientific forums.
Dr Hema Weerakoon has awarded Sri Lanka Medical Association Fairmed 2013/2016 (Health for poorest) research grant award in 2013 and 2016. She has got research award in merit category from national research council of Sri Lanka in 2010, 2011 and 2015. She is also co-investigator of ECLIPSE research award in Sri Lankan team. She is the only medical officer who is working in government health sector of Sri Lanka in ECLIPSE project. All others are working in universities in Sri Lanka.
She also has got Primary health care innovation fund award under ADB health system enhancement project (HSEP/PMU/NCP/THA/01.1/2020) for leishmaniasis awareness and advocacy in Anuradhapura, Sri Lanka.

Hema Weerakoon is engaging in community education in native language of Sri Lanka for more than 15 years. She has done more than 70 awareness programs on leishmaniasis for health staff, non-health staff, community and school children. Other than that she is doing awareness programs on dermatological disease chronic kidney disease, non communicable disease and productivity. She is writing to new papers and journals in Sri Lanka regarding leishmaniasis as well as other diseases since 2009. She is author of five books published in Sri Lanka and co-author of five books published in Sri Lanka. She is the author of first booklet on leishmaniasis in Sinhala medium in Sri Lanka (2011).
